#2135c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2135cd is composed of 12.9% red, 20.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#2135cd color hex could be obtained by blending #426aff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2135c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2135cd has RGB values of R:33, G:53,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2176461.

Shades and Tints of #2135c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2135c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73747b is the less saturated color, while #0620e8 is the most saturated one.
